Course Content

• Introduction to Medical Device Regulations and Standards
• Hazard Analysis and Risk Management in Medical Device Development (including FMEA, FTA, and risk matrices)
• Risk Assessment Methodologies and Tools for Medical Devices
• Usability Engineering and Human Factors in Risk Assessment
• Statistical Methods for Risk Analysis in Medical Device Applications
• Regulatory Compliance and Post-Market Surveillance for Medical Devices
• Case Studies in Medical Device Risk Assessment and Management
• Biocompatibility and Bioburden Testing in Risk Mitigation
• Medical Device Cybersecurity and Risk Mitigation

Career path

Career Role Description
Medical Device Risk Manager Lead risk assessment activities, ensuring compliance with regulations (e.g., ISO 14971). High demand in the UK medical device sector.
Regulatory Affairs Specialist (Medical Devices) Manage regulatory submissions and ensure compliance with UKCA and EU MDR. A crucial role requiring strong risk assessment skills.
Quality Assurance Engineer (Medical Devices) Oversee quality systems, including risk management processes. Involved in post-market surveillance and risk mitigation strategies.
Clinical Risk Manager Focus on clinical risks associated with medical devices, performing risk analysis and contributing to risk mitigation plans. Growing demand in the UK.
